Todd Duncan is a retired American soccer defender who spent two seasons in the USL A-League.

Duncan graduated from Bellarmine High School. He attended San Jose State University as a two-sport athlete in baseball and soccer.[1] His soccer skills brought him to the attention of the San Jose Clash who selected him in the third round (27th overall) of the 1999 MLS College Draft.[2] The San Francisco Bay Seals also drafted Duncan, in the 1999 USL A-League draft.[3] Duncan signed with the Seals and played for them in 1999 and 2000.
